Scotland faced a tough lesson in their Euro 2024 opener, suffering a 5-1 defeat to a dominant Germany in Munich. Angus Gunn couldn’t stop Florian Wirtz’s early strike, setting the tone for the match. Jamal Musiala and Kai Havertz extended Germany’s lead, with Havertz’s penalty following Ryan Porteous’ red card for a harsh tackle on Ilkay Gundogan.

Niclas Fullkrug’s stunning shot added to Scotland’s woes. An own goal by Antonio Rudiger gave Scotland a brief respite, but Emre Can sealed Germany’s biggest opening match win at the Euros with a final goal. Steve Clarke’s team now faces an uphill battle in the tournament.
